I'm pretty good at doing panels that can be ordered through front panel express. this makes it easy for the end user to purchase a panel from a 3rd party and the panel gets made on demand. one less thing you have to worry about. one more good thing for potential buyers. for modular use, you should make it so it fits in a eurorack module with PCB mount parts and PCB mounting parallel to the panel. if it fits euro, it will fit ALL other modular formats. euro is the most popular. you could sell 20 kits just like that. other formats fly all the wires and use PCB mounting brackets. the first module I got was a euro kit with no panel that I built in a 5.25x8.75inch panel from front panel express. just start a thread in DIY at muffwiggler.com with the title "bit crusher PCB's first run" or something. I don't how difficult it will be to get the PCB mount panel components all worked out with no CAD. the power and physical dimensions are documented here http://www.doepfer.de/DIY/a100_diy.htm
the DIY forum has lots of threads where people talk part numbers, mounting height etc..if you do it right you could make some good money. the guitar version should be on a simpler smaller PCB that is not voltage controlled.

That works out fine for me since I fly all my wires in my diy modules. Im on 15v so i guess i need a 5v regulator for the pic right? I can handle the attenuation and make up gain on a daughter board.
WWW.EATYOURGUITAR.COM <---- MY DIY STUFF
- multi_s
- IAMILF

- Posts: 2098
- Joined: Mon Feb 15, 2010 9:00 pm
Re: any interest in "bitcrusher" ics?
Yes well you could overcome this problem seamlessly without even having to worry.
Run everything on the 5v regulator until the final output stage. Run the last output stage off of V+ which coudl be either 9volts or 15 volts or as high as you want as long as the opa is built for that high a voltage, which is not uncommon at all. put a gain knob on that stage adn away you go. or simply hardwire a gain which is the inverse of the attenuation you applied pre pic.
But hey 15vpp signal is quite large. Is it common to have the audio so huge in modular synths? I built a soundlab, despite it running of +-9volts the output audio signals are more like 1 volt pp or less. BUt thats really my only experience with that stuff.

Every module is designed to take and output a 10vpp signal. Usually the posative only control voltages like envelopes or note pitch are 0 to +5v. Thats why the power rails are always 12 or 15v bipolar. It gives your opamps some headroom. Many people have blown nice speakers hooking up the first modular. Euro rack, as-in doepfer, is 12v bipolar power but all the signals are within 5vpp. Thats a bit more reasonable but still needs %90 attenuation.
